Ticket: Archival job skips cold storage buckets with trailing-slash prefixes. Repro: create a bucket in the Nimbark console, set lifecycle to cold tier, add an object under a prefix ending in a slash, then run the archiver. Expected: object archived. Actual: job exits zero with nothing moved. To rerun the archiver manually, authenticate with the credential below.

session JWT of yawep-yawep = eyJhbGciOiJIUzI1NiIsInR5cCI6IkpXVCJ9.eyJzdWIiOiI3pWF3_In0.aXYsHiog

Quarterly Planning Note — Divestiture of the Coastal Tooling Unit

For the finance team: the sale of the Coastal Tooling unit to Pellmark Industries remains on track for close in Q3. Please finalize the carve-out balance sheet, reconcile intercompany positions, and prepare the working-capital adjustment schedule by month-end. Audit support requests should be prioritized. For planning purposes, note the following sensitive item:

internal memo for hawef-kahif: The finance team signed off on a budget of $25.9 million for Project Sorox. The renewal with Pelokek Logistics closes at $51.7 million a year, 52 percent below the last contract.

Dear dispatch desk, please arrange collection of the calibration weight set from our Fennwick Instruments lab for delivery to the Halloway receiving site. The set comprises eight stainless weights in a sealed transit case with shock indicators on both ends. Keep the case upright and avoid temperature extremes, as the certificates are voided if the indicators trip. The receiving technician will only release a signature after the courier states the following phrase:

courier memo of yawep-yafog: the pramir ulaix courier leaves the ulavan aldix frair zorok oliiel joreth rusdor fenvan ledger at gate 1305 under passcode 514738

**Q: What does the Skimmerhawk sweeper do?**

A: It scans the Velden cloud accounts nightly for orphaned volumes, stale load balancers, and unattached addresses, then deletes anything unowned for 14 days. Deletions are reversible for 72 hours via the quarantine bucket. Don't disable it without lead approval. To restore an item from quarantine, unlock the restore tool with the recovery passphrase below.

strongbox words: praath-pelys-ulaion